Depends on how much they like the player and how confident they are that they can sign him I guess. You're right there's not much precedent, but for 5-10 slots I don't think it's much of a price to pay, especially with this year's draft considered to be decent at the top of the 1st but pretty poor depth wise.

If the context is that he just wants to go to an organization with less centre depth and would sign for one of any 5 teams, getting to the head of the line probably makes sense. Being able to sign him now is a bargaining advantage, he can come in to their NHL or AHL team this week and get started. It's not like he's a real UFA, his salary is going to be capped at rookie max so they'll all be the same deals with maybe some minor bonus fluctuation. Maybe he wants to burn a year, or maybe he just wants to get started with the organization and not come into training camp cold.
